static_call: Relax static_call_update() function argument type
static_call_update() had stronger type requirements than regular C, relax them to match. Instead of requiring the @func argument has the exact matching type, allow any type which C is willing to promote to the right (function) pointer type. Specifically this allows (void *) arguments. This cleans up a bunch of static_call_update() callers for PREEMPT_DYNAMIC and should get around silly GCC11 warnings for free.
